The Cost of Living - Alaska

    https://live.laborstats.alaska.gov/col/col.pdf
    The fi rst quarter 2019 C2ER survey again showed that costs in Anchorage, Fairbanks, and Juneau remain well above the na onal average. Given an index value of 100 for the U.S. average, Anchorage’s cost index weighed in at 127.4 points, or 27.4 percent higher. (See Exhibit 8.) Fairbanks came in at 128.0 and Juneau at 134.2.
